Originally designed in 1967 by Verner Panton, the Series 430 Chair is a celebrated piece of Danish modern design that seamlessly blends simplicity, comfort, and sophistication. Its gently curved, fully upholstered shell is crafted to support the body naturally, offering a comfortable seating experience ideal for both dining and extended use.
The chair’s clean silhouette is complemented by slim, minimalist metal legs, creating a refined balance between softness and structure. This contrast gives the Series 430 its signature lightness, making it suitable for contemporary interiors while retaining its mid-century heritage.
Produced today by Verpan, the Series 430 remains a timeless choice for dining rooms, hospitality spaces, and design-forward environments—where understated elegance and functional comfort are essential.
